The Savitribai Phule Pune University (SPPU) on Tuesday rescheduled the examinations at its affiliated colleges that were slated to be held on June 29. The SPPU’s Board of Examinations and Evaluation said the decision was taken since both Bakrid and Ashadi Ekadashi are falling on June 29.

The university has directed the affiliated colleges to hold the affected examinations on July 9. A circular issued by the Board of Examination and Evaluations read, “After receiving requests from some of the affiliated colleges that festivals of Bakrid and Ashadhi Ekadashi are to be celebrated on June 29, the board has decided to postpone all the examinations at the affiliated colleges in Pune, Ahmednagar and Nashik districts. These should be held on Sunday, July 9, 2023, as per the timetables of the rest of the examination.”

Examinations for the final semesters of diploma, degree and master’s courses of the academic year 2022-23 commenced at various affiliated colleges of the SPPU on June 6. The exams are being held in the offline mode.

Meanwhile, SPPU’s convocation ceremony will be held on July 1. Maharashtra Governor and Chancellor of Universities Ramesh Bais will be the chief guest. At least 1,21,281 students have applied to get the certificates of completion of various courses. At the event, students who have won gold medals and selected PhD holders will be handed out degrees while others will be sent the certificates through post.
